Date: Thu, 30 May 2013 23:32:17 +0200 From: nemysis <nemysis@gmx.ch> To: FreeBSD-gnats-submit@freebsd.org Cc: jpaetzel@freebsd.org Subject: ports/179130: [PATCH] multimedia/vcdgear: Convert to OptionsNG, trim comment and docs Message-ID: <20130530213226.EA690D64@hub.freebsd.org> Resent-Message-ID: <201305302140.r4ULe0Q0063152@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 179130 >Category: ports >Synopsis: [PATCH] multimedia/vcdgear: Convert to OptionsNG, trim comment and docs >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Thu May 30 21:40:00 UTC 2013 >Closed-Date: >Last-Modified: >Originator: nemysis >Release: FreeBSD 9.1-RELEASE amd64 >Organization: >Environment: System: FreeBSD FreeBSD_Ports 9.1-RELEASE FreeBSD 9.1-RELEASE #0: Tue Jan 29 15:02:50 EST 2013 >Description: - Shorten header - Trim comment - Convert to OptionsNG - Trim docs - Remove pkg-plist Removed file(s): - pkg-plist Generated and tested manually, tested with port test and with RedPorts, sent with FreeBSD Port Tools 0.99_6 (mode: change, diff: ports) >How-To-Repeat: Build log https://redports.org/buildarchive/20130530202301-46110/ >Fix: --- vcdgear-1.6d.patch begins here --- diff -ruN --exclude=CVS /usr/ports/multimedia/vcdgear/Makefile ./Makefile --- /usr/ports/multimedia/vcdgear/Makefile 2013-01-14 17:54:56.000000000 +0100 +++ ./Makefile 2013-05-30 23:29:41.000000000 +0200 @@ -1,9 +1,5 @@ -# New ports collection makefile for: vcdgear -# Date created: 06 January 1999 -# Whom: Chris Piazza <cpiazza@FreeBSD.org> -# +# Created by: Chris Piazza <cpiazza@FreeBSD.org> # $FreeBSD: head/multimedia/vcdgear/Makefile 300896 2012-07-14 13:54:48Z beat $ -# PORTNAME= vcdgear PORTVERSION= 1.6d @@ -11,11 +7,16 @@ MASTER_SITES= http://www.vcdgear.com/files/ MAINTAINER= ports@FreeBSD.org -COMMENT= A tool to convert VCDs from cue/bin format to mpeg +COMMENT= Tool to convert VCDs from cue/bin format to mpeg ONLY_FOR_ARCHS= alpha i386 amd64 +PLIST_FILES= bin/${PORTNAME} + +PORTDOCS= faq.txt manual.txt whatsnew.txt + .include <bsd.port.pre.mk> +.include <bsd.port.options.mk> .if ${ARCH} == i386 || ${ARCH} == amd64 DISTNAME= ${PORTNAME}16d_i386_freebsd42 @@ -27,12 +28,10 @@ WRKSRC= ${WRKDIR}/vcdgear16 do-install: - ${INSTALL_PROGRAM} ${WRKSRC}/vcdgear16_static ${PREFIX}/bin/vcdgear -.if !defined(NOPORTDOCS) + ${INSTALL_PROGRAM} ${WRKSRC}/vcdgear16_static ${PREFIX}/bin/${PORTNAME} +.if ${PORT_OPTIONS:MDOCS} @${MKDIR} ${DOCSDIR} -.for file in faq.txt manual.txt whatsnew.txt - ${INSTALL_DATA} ${WRKSRC}/${file} ${DOCSDIR} -.endfor + ${INSTALL_DATA} ${PORTDOCS:S|^|${WRKSRC}/|} ${DOCSDIR} .endif .include <bsd.port.post.mk> diff -ruN --exclude=CVS /usr/ports/multimedia/vcdgear/distinfo ./distinfo --- /usr/ports/multimedia/vcdgear/distinfo 2013-01-14 17:54:56.000000000 +0100 +++ ./distinfo 2013-03-29 16:29:12.000000000 +0100 @@ -1,4 +1,2 @@ -SHA256 (vcdgear16d_alpha_freebsd41.tar.gz) = cedce8180bd7e4959aaa3b26d4e83d0804c156c94168a1ef7f0f7259f91159e8 -SIZE (vcdgear16d_alpha_freebsd41.tar.gz) = 121796 SHA256 (vcdgear16d_i386_freebsd42.tar.gz) = c90cc63ff402ab6bcfc545d9b534bd3ce86954d8a5b2069554174073b73bf432 SIZE (vcdgear16d_i386_freebsd42.tar.gz) = 98035 diff -ruN --exclude=CVS /usr/ports/multimedia/vcdgear/pkg-plist ./pkg-plist --- /usr/ports/multimedia/vcdgear/pkg-plist 2013-01-14 17:54:56.000000000 +0100 +++ ./pkg-plist 1970-01-01 01:00:00.000000000 +0100 @@ -1,5 +0,0 @@ -bin/vcdgear -%%PORTDOCS%%share/doc/vcdgear/faq.txt -%%PORTDOCS%%share/doc/vcdgear/manual.txt -%%PORTDOCS%%share/doc/vcdgear/whatsnew.txt -%%PORTDOCS%%@dirrm share/doc/vcdgear --- vcdgear-1.6d.patch ends here --- >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20130530213226.EA690D64>